Bonjour,
Je dois reprendre un site en Joomla. Ce site un peu des problèmes...
Je n'arrive pas à m'identifier depuis le site (pas la console d'admin). Je mets mes identifiants mais rien ne se passe...
Une idée ?
Joomla v. 1.0.15
Bonjour,
Je dois reprendre un site en Joomla. Ce site un peu des problèmes...
Je n'arrive pas à m'identifier depuis le site (pas la console d'admin). Je mets mes identifiants mais rien ne se passe...
Une idée ?
Joomla v. 1.0.15
Dernière modification par Invité ; 11/11/2008 à 13h55.
Bonjour,
vérifie si tu as un répertoire sessions... Vérifie également si une session se lance (regarde via phpmyadmin).
As tu un message d'erreur?? As tu essayé en local??
Bon courage
Quel est ton hébergeur? car sur certain il est impératif de créer un dossier "sessions" a la racine du site... Essaie cela déjà.
Si ça peut aider, j'ai trouvé ça dans les logs d'erreur :
[Thu Nov 13 08:42:47 2008] [error] [client xxx.xxx.xxx.xxx] File does not exist: C:/APACHE/htdocs/lesite/modules/mod_yoo_slider, referer: http://www.lesite.com/index.php?option= ... Itemid=121
[Thu Nov 13 08:42:47 2008] [error] [client xxx.xxx.xxx.xxx] File does not exist: C:/APACHE/htdocs/lesite/modules/mod_yoo_carousel, referer: http://www.lesite.com/index.php?option= ... Itemid=121
[Thu Nov 13 08:42:47 2008] [error] [client xxx.xxx.xxx.xxx] File does not exist: C:/APACHE/htdocs/lesite/modules/mod_yoo_drawer, referer: http://www.lesite.com/index.php?option= ... Itemid=121
[Thu Nov 13 08:42:47 2008] [error] [client xxx.xxx.xxx.xxx] File does not exist: C:/APACHE/htdocs/lesite/modules/mod_yoo_accordion, referer: http://www.lesite.com/index.php?option= ... Itemid=121
[Thu Nov 13 08:42:47 2008] [error] [client xxx.xxx.xxx.xxx] File does not exist: C:/APACHE/htdocs/lesite/modules/mod_yoo_toppanel, referer: http://www.lesite.com/index.php?option= ... Itemid=121
[Thu Nov 13 08:43:03 2008] [error] [client xxx.xxx.xxx.xxx] File does not exist: C:/APACHE/htdocs/lesite/modules/mod_yoo_drawer, referer: http://www.lesite.com/
[Thu Nov 13 08:43:03 2008] [error] [client xxx.xxx.xxx.xxx] File does not exist: C:/APACHE/htdocs/lesite/modules/mod_yoo_carousel, referer: http://www.lesite.com/
[Thu Nov 13 08:43:03 2008] [error] [client xxx.xxx.xxx.xxx] File does not exist: C:/APACHE/htdocs/lesite/modules/mod_yoo_slider, referer: http://www.lesite.com/
[Thu Nov 13 08:43:03 2008] [error] [client xxx.xxx.xxx.xxx] File does not exist: C:/APACHE/htdocs/lesite/modules/mod_yoo_toppanel, referer: http://www.lesite.com/
[Thu Nov 13 08:43:03 2008] [error] [client xxx.xxx.xxx.xxx] File does not exist: C:/APACHE/htdocs/lesite/modules/mod_yoo_accordion, referer: http://www.lesite.com/
Est-ce que le problème de connexion peut venir de ces fichiers manquants ?
Je pense que oui..
connecte toi à ta base, vas dans la table module puis affiche les enregistrements. Cherche ceux qui ont dans la colonne "module" une des valeurs correspondant au fichiers manquants puis passe les en "publish" =0.
Ton site est visible du net?? si oui, tu peux m'envoyer via mp ou mail un lien, je peux regarder le problème..
essaie cette adresse : lesite.com/administrator pour voir si le problème vient bien des fichiers manquant...
Le pire c'est que j'ai déjà vu une discussion du genre sur le forum de joola.fr mais il est pas disponible pour le moment...
Tiens moi au courant
Apparemment le site a été installé avec un template (yootheme) qui nécessite plusieurs modules Yoo.
J'ai été sur la console du site (lesite.com/administrator) et de là, j'ai dé-publié tous les modules de type YOO. J'ai ensuite activer un template banal pour joomla 1.0.15 et j'ai aussi re-publier le module identification.
Rien à faire, la connexion en frontend ne fonctionne pas... J'ai également ouvert la même discussion sur les forums de joomla.org sans résultat...
Je relance le sujet pasque là je galère vraiment à fond...
C'est normal que quand il veut se connecter, il aille chercher des fichiers dans components -> com_login ?
Du nouveau, j'ai copié mon site en local pour tester. J'ai donc exactement les mêmes fichiers et la même base de données. Là, aucun problème pour se connecter.
Problème de serveur ? D'où cela peut-il venir ?
J'ai remarqué quelque chose d'important je pense aujourd'hui.
Mon site et mon serveur apache sont configurés en UTF-8. Ma base de données, en Latin1.
Est-ce que le problème de connexion peut venir de cette différence de charset ?
Que dois-je faire sachant que je ne peux pas modifier la base de données...
il faut vérifier aussi certains paramètres apache tels que le répertoire où sont stockées les sessions, le magic quotes et le registrer globals.
Quel est l'historique de la maintenance sur ce site? car un problème de session ne vient pas tout d'un coup.
Voilà ce que j'ai trouvé. Pour magic quotes et register globals c'est pas dans apache mais dans php :
Les sessions sont stockées dans la base de données et pas dans un dossier.
Code : Sélectionner tout - Visualiser dans une fenêtre à part
1
2
3
4
5
6
7
8
9
10
11
12
13
14 register_globals = Off ; Magic quotes ; ; Magic quotes for incoming GET/POST/Cookie data. magic_quotes_gpc = On ; Magic quotes for runtime-generated data, e.g. data from SQL, from exec(), etc. magic_quotes_runtime = Off ; Use Sybase-style magic quotes (escape ' with '' instead of \'). magic_quotes_sybase = Off
Qu'est-ce que tu entends par historique de maintenance ?
Excuse moi pour la sémantique... tu as effectivement raison.
j'entend par historique de maintenance le fait que tu ai repris un site ou tu n'arrive pas à te connecter en admin est assez étrange. afin de te donner de bonnes pistes c'est important de savoir si tu as déjà réussi à te connecter ou jamais. car pour installer les modules de yootheme qui semblent être présent il a bien fallu s'y connecter un jour.
car au final peut être que tu n'as simplement pas le bon mot de passe. il existe alors un script pour le faire sauter (faut quand même avoir les autorisation FTP rassurez vous).
es-tu sur qu'il ne manque pas des fichiers? je ne connais pas les conditions de cette reprise de site mais
ca cela veut dire que des fichiers ont été supprimé sans passé par le programme de deésintallation en Back-office.[Thu Nov 13 08:43:03 2008] [error] [client xxx.xxx.xxx.xxx] File does not exist: C:/APACHE/htdocs/lesite/modules/mod_yoo_carousel, referer: http://www.lesite.com/
As-tu vérifier que le core joomla était bien complet?
sinon si t'en a marre de galéré, tu peux installer un composant de sauvegardre de base pour joomla. réinstaller un nouveau joomla avec tous les composants, modules et mambots utilisés puis faire une restauration avec ce même composant
Partager